β,β,β-Trifluoro-β'-hydroxy-isobutyric acid amide is a complex organic compound with the molecular formula C5H7F3NO3. It is characterized by the presence of three fluorine atoms attached to the β-carbon, a hydroxyl group on the β'-carbon, and an amide functional group. β,β,β-trifluoro-β'-hydroxy-isobutyric acid amide is a derivative of isobutyric acid, which has been modified to include fluorine atoms and a hydroxyl group, enhancing its chemical properties. It is often used in the synthesis of pharmaceuticals and other organic compounds due to its unique reactivity and stability. The presence of fluorine atoms can significantly alter the physical and chemical properties of the molecule, such as its lipophilicity and metabolic stability, making it a valuable building block in the development of new drugs and chemical compounds.
